绳索取芯钻进工艺在提高钻进效率与取芯率、降低劳动强度和降低钻探综合成本等方面所具有的优势,普通取芯钻进无法比拟。适用于φ88.9 mm钻具的绳索取芯器,因施工设计中对取芯岩芯直径要求,对工艺进行改进,改进后绳索取芯器可适用于φ114.3 mm钻具。针对取芯过程中出现的跳钻、上提打捞器卡钻、绳索钢丝绳打圈、取芯钻头磨损严重等问题,采取措施有效解决了以上问题,以超高的采取率成功钻穿煤层、煤系。
The advantages of rope coring drilling technology improves drilling efficiency,coring rate,reducing labor intensity and comprehensive cost of drilling are incomparable to that of ordinary core drilling.The rope coring tool is suitable for φ88.9 mm drilling tools.Due to the requirements of core diameter in the construction design,the process was improved.After the improvement,the rope coring tool can be suitable for φ114.3 mm drilling tools.In view of the problems in the process of coring,such as drilling jump,lifting fishing device stuck,rope and wire rope looped,coring drill bit wear,etc.,various measures were taken to effectively solve the above problems,which successfully drilled through coal seam and coal measures with an ultra-high adoption rate.
